what sentence most clearly states how Mr. white's son feels when they first hear the story of the Monkey's paw

Answer: The monkey's paw, according to Mr. White's son, was a huge joke (D is your answer).

Explanation: We can tell that the kid does not believe the monkey paw has any magic in this remark, "Well, I don't see the money," replied his son as he took it up and set it on the table, "and I bet I never shall." He believes it is a farce that will not function.
